DIY Can Lower Your Deduction

In a normal case, you can deduct both the cost of the labor and the cost of the materials for your new fence. However, you can’t deduct the cost of your own labor- which means if you choose to DIY your fence you could miss out on some of the tax savings. There are also several other reasons why a DIY fence is a bad idea, so consider all factors before endeavoring to install a new fence yourself.
